Priority Technology Holdings (NASDAQ: PRTH) is set to unveil its innovative MX POS solutions at the ETA Transact 2023 event in Atlanta, taking place from April 24-26. The MX POS is a cloud-based, customizable solution designed for businesses, offering enhanced cash flow, analytics, and operational support. It integrates with leading delivery services like DoorDash and Uber Eats, as well as accounting tools like QuickBooks. The system targets restaurants, retail, and various merchants, aiming to streamline payment processes and boost average sales. Priority's CEO, Thomas Priore, emphasized the importance of supporting small to medium-sized businesses in the current economic landscape. Priority Technology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: PRTH) reported strong financial results for Q4 and full year 2022, highlighting a 23.3% year-over-year revenue increase to $177.6 million, and a 25.3% rise in adjusted gross profit to $61.0 million. For the full year, revenue reached $663.6 million, a 28.9% increase, with adjusted gross profit rising by 46.4% to $226.9 million. The adjusted gross profit margin improved to 34.2%. The company forecasts 2023 revenue between $740 million and $755 million, reflecting 12% to 14% growth, and adjusted EBITDA between $160 million and $165 million, indicating a 14% to 18% growth rate. CEO Tom Priore emphasized the company's resilience in challenging economic conditions.

Priority Technology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: PRTH) has announced a strategic partnership with IQ BackOffice to enhance accounts payable capabilities through the integration of Priority's CPX solution. This collaboration aims to streamline accounting processes and automate payments via multiple modalities like check, ACH, and virtual card, promising efficiency and up to 70% cost reduction for clients. The integration is expected to digitalize financial processes, lowering risks and enhancing returns on investment. Priority Technology Holdings has announced partnerships with Factor4 and GiftYa to enhance their gift card offerings. Through the collaboration with Factor4, Priority customers gain access to omnichannel gift card and loyalty solutions, facilitating seamless transactions across various platforms. Factor4 aims to boost merchants' revenue while providing full support. GiftYa's platform allows personalized e-gifting for over 250,000 merchants nationwide, offering innovative card-linked gifting solutions. This strategic move positions Priority to meet growing demands in the gift card sector, ultimately helping merchants retain customers and increase profitability.
Priority Technology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: PRTH) has appointed Marc Crisafulli as a Director, bringing over 30 years of legal and regulatory experience. Crisafulli previously held senior positions at Bally’s Corporation, Brightstar Corporation, and Suffolk Construction Company. His expertise is expected to enhance Priority's growth in new enterprise payment verticals. Crisafulli holds a bachelor's degree from Boston University and a juris doctorate from Georgetown University, and he will participate on various board committees.
